I did the first survey. Couldn't understand your second question, as the objective was not clear at all (so I couldn't answer if/how I would invest myself in this venture). I left my feedback in the survey.

A few things about developing good survey (questions):
- clear, specific questions, that are free of false assumptions/avoid creating false dichotomy (are you measuring what you're aiming to measure? Validity; is your objective clear? Is that captured in the questions? Relevance; Your first survey wasn't)
- answer key must be comprehensive yet clear and concise
- be objective, no loaded questions
- simple language (your survey was great in this regard)
